Clay licks, or "collpas" in Quechua, are basically superior focus deposits of minerals which might be hard to come by inside the rain forest. For parrots and macaws they can be found in the shape of river lender clay deposits, but mammals sometimes Assemble all around exposed soil in the bottom, monkeys lick tree trunks with sediments and butterflies flutter about beaches exactly where nutrient- rich liquids have evaporated. Clay licks are Consequently a common rather than so unheard of phenomenon during the rain forest. Undoubtedly the most well-liked wildlife spectacle around Tambopata Investigation Middle, and the a single for which Tambopata is among the most famed for may be the macaw clay lick, less then 300 meters from your lodge itself. This certain clay lick is a big, 50 meter tall cliff of reddish clay that extends for around five hundred meters together the west bank of your Tambopata River. Whilst quite a few clay licks are identified to exist alongside the streams and rivers from the Tambopata Candamo Reserved Zone, the one particular in Tambopata is not simply the most important identified, but in addition the only real a single where by Blue-and-gold macaws are regarded to descend to eat clay.
